MI SJRD | 2013-2014 | 97th Legislature

Status

Spectrum: Partisan Bill (Republican 1-0)
Status: Introduced on January 16 2013 - 25% progression, died in committee
Action: 2013-01-16 - Referred To Committee On Reforms, Restructuring And Reinventing
Pending: Senate Reforms, Restructuring And Reinventing Committee
Text: Latest bill text (Introduced) [HTML]

Summary

Legislature; other; budget process; require legislature to present all general appropriation bills to the governor 90 days before the start of a fiscal period and require forfeiture of certain legislators' salaries for failure to present those bills by that date. Amends sec. 31, art. IV & adds sec. 55 to art. IV of the state constitution.
